Hawaii town nearly gone As lava assault continues Kaapana Hawaii apr residents of this vanishing town struggled thursday to save prize possessions As fiery lava from Kilauea Volcano slowed steadily toward their Homes. Lovenia Kamelamela who lives in a House built by her great Grandfather in 1886, worried about her Coconut Trees. She said she would remove As Many As possible before authorities order her to evacuate the property for her own safety. In the Center of the coastal town at the Kaapana store and drive in owner Walter Yamaguchi vowed to stay open even though Hawaii county civil defense authorities planned to erect a Roadblock to keep people away from the store. The Volcano 6 Miles away has spewed lava to within 250 Yards of the store. A this is my property. I can open if i want a Yamaguchi said. A i am not moving because she will Stop a he added referring to the Volcano with the respectful a a she used by Many hawaiian islanders. Three Homes were destroyed wednesday and five tuesday. A total of 129 have been consumed since Kilauea began erupting in january 1983. The lava is so hot there is no Way to Stop it. Dousing it with water blocking it with Sand trying to erect barricades have All been futile As the lava flows from the Volcano to the sea obliterating everything in its path. More than 50 houses have been destroyed in the past month. In Kaapana where 125 Homes once stood Only 30 remain. Soon the whole Village will be gone. Workers were preparing thursday to pick up and move the towns roman Catholic Church named the Star of the sea. The a painted Church a so called because of the brightly coloured murals on its Interior Walls is directly in the path of the lava which had approached to within 350 Yards by thursday morning. Across the Street the Kaapana Mauna Kea congregational Church is staying put and awaiting its Fate. The Church originally built in 1823, was destroyed by an earthquake lava flow and tidal wave in 1868. Another quake forced the rebuilding of the Church at its present site in 1935. The approach appears to be the first Quick practical cure for the night shift blues the on the Job sleepiness and daytime insomnia that plague Many of the nations 7 million night workers. The principal Developer or. Charles a. Czeisler of Bostons Brigham and women a Hospital said his team is still simplifying the technique so it can be easily moved from lab to workplace. But if it matches its Early Promise it should readjust Peoples biological rhythms in just two nights so they stay awake when their bodies ordinarily want to sleep. A a it a a tremendous leap Forward a said or. Thomas Roth a sleep researcher at Henry Ford Hospital in Detroit. The technique works this Way people moving to the night shift reported to work a in this Case a Hospital lab a at Midnight and spent the next eight hours sitting at a desk. While they worked a Bank of lights 4 feet away shined with 16 Cool White 40-Watt bulbs. After work they pulled Down blackout shades in the bedroom of their Home staying in total darkness from 9 . To 5 . After just two Days the time on the workers internal clocks shifted almost 10 hours. So instead of hitting the Low Point in their daily Cycle about 5 ., this happened around 3 . When they were still asleep. A they certainly have made a breakthrough in understanding the effect of Light on humans a said or. Mary Carskadon of Brown University in Providence . A their evidence is very powerful. There needs to be More trials in the Field to determine the Efficacy in a broader sense but i think that what they be done really gives us a guidepost to pursuing this Czeisler described the results of his groups experimental use of the approach on eight Young men in a report in thursdays new England journal of Medicine. If the technique can be successfully adapted to the Job it could be important for an estimated 7 million . Night workers. Even after years on night schedules some people complain they never completely adjust. A a it a very important in critical jobs to make sure that people Are Alert on the night shift a said Czeisler. A we collected data on 4,000 shift workers and found that 56 percent reported nodding off at least once a week. Carskadon temperature. Ordinarily Peoples temperatures hit their lowest ebb in the wee hours and this is when they arc least Alert if they happen to be awake. During the studies a comparison group worked at night under regular lights and slept with Ordinary window shades pulled. After a week their temperatures continued to reach their Low Point during the Early morning hours. In contrast those who got the Light dark treatment noticed an immediate improvement in their alertness and performance. A your subjects said it was startling How much better they fell at night a said Czeisler. A it was no longer an ordeal to stay up All those getting the treatment were Able to sleep two hours longer a Day than the comparison group. Tests also showed dramatic shifts in when their bodies made hormones and produced urine. The work provides new clues about the effect of Light signals that travel along nerves from the eyes to the brains hypothalamus the metronome that keeps All the body a functions running on time. However before employers Start changing Light bulbs Czeisler said More study needs to be done to simplify the necessary Light array test the approach on older people and women and see How it works on larger groups. Still he said the research a demonstrates for the first time a reliable procedure for inducing physiological adaption for night shift work. Spurned Bride wins slander suit against husband London apr spurned pakistani Bride Zahida Seemi won $32,800 in slander damages wednesday against her husband and his parents who claimed she was not a Virgin when she married. Seemie a claim was a rare action brought under an 1891 slander of women act. The High court in London was told that on their wedding night in August 1981, Mohammed Nasir Sadiq told her she was a not Good and had been associating sexually with other men. He refused to consummate their marriage but said he would consider keeping her if her parents gave Sadiq and his parents the equivalent of $4,485, the court was told. They were married in London according to the rites of islam and Sadiq said he would go through an English civil marriage if the $4,485 was paid the court was told. After 13 Days they left for Pakistan where Seemi said she heard from friends that members of his family were repeating stories of her infidelity. The Money was not paid and a moslem divorce followed. Seemi 30, who lives with her sick Mother in Pakistan wept As she told Justice Michael Davies through an interpreter that she had suffered greatly and had been living in the Hope that the court would Clear her character. A otherwise i have no desire to live anymore in this world a she said.
